I found this place through a Google search while staying in Scott, LA for a meeting. The place was cute, clean and the staff was super friendly. I had a hearty breakfast and found the prices very fair.
What a wonderfully, enjoyable, and pleasant home. Yes, I know its a coffee shop but it felt like home. I truly enjoyed the people, atmosphere, and the the kindness of the owner and staff. My family was searching for beignets and coffee after the Thanksgiving holiday and found the Coffee Depot. Although they were minutes from closing for the day they welcome us like family and remained open to give us a wonderful time. And as and added treat we picked up two of their signature coffee cups by Deneen Pottery. Just a wonderful place to go when your tank is low and you are seeking warmth, kindness and great beignets.
This is the cutest little breakfast place in Scott! Train themed decor everywhere, a little choo choose bell every time and order is up, a lot of food options at really good prices. My husband and I ordered a few things and shared. The pancakes were huge! The beignets were awesome. My only MINOR preference complaint is the grits and eggs didn't have any season on them. This could be great for those watching calories, cholesterol, or sodium though. We added salt and pepper, but I would have liked real butter for the grits instead of vegetable oil spread, that adds no flavor for me. The bacon was the BEST, sausage was good, and we loved the chopped up sausage in the white gravy. The frozen coffee was really good as well!
